Chapter Thirteen:
Everyone Breaks
I have been sitting on the floor of my room for about half an hour with my eyes closed.
My dad told me a leader must be able to sit still and process everything that has occurred when they get the chance. It turns out itâs useful for teenaged girls who have just been rejected by the guy they like.
Iâm trying to meditate and be a good little leader, but itâs hard because I keep getting flashes of Aaden and me. Itâs like watching your favorite movie and being afraid to get to the end. Thatâs because youâve seen the movie before and you know things will go horribly wrong. I watch all the way up to the part where he lays me down and then I ârewindâ the movie.
Being with Aaden up until that moment felt surreal. I didnât know my body could have its own mind. I didnât know it was capable of screaming out for someone like it did for Aaden. Every single cell in me wanted, needed him. And he felt the same way. Or at least I thought he did.
Why did he stop? Did I do something wrong? Could I have kissed better? Should I have showered first? Was he turned off by the size of my breasts? Should I have played âhard to getâ? Iâve read a lot of human magazines and supposedly human males like that. Do male angels feel the same?
Donât do this Pry; donât start questioning everything, because it wonât get you anywhere.
Itâll just confuse you and make you even more upset. Be a grown-up and let it go. So you and Aaden made out, so what? Let it go.
I text Randy repeatedly, but I guess heâs still in a funk because he doesnât reply. I check my watch and we now have a little more than six hours to save Uncle Rage. I make myself get up off the floor and put my âFirst Noruâ hat on. Itâs time to think about more important things than my love life, or the lack of it.
I take a quick shower and change clothes. As Iâm about to walk out of my room, I hear someone enter Keyâs room next door. Judging by the three voices, itâs Bex, East, and Aaden. I guess they are having some kind of conference that the girls werenât invited to.
âSilver, what the hell did you do to her?â Bex demands.
âIs that what you brought me in here to ask?â Aaden replies, on edge.
âYouâre damn right I did. Why do you keep fucking with Pry like this?â Bex accuses.
âI donât owe you or anyone an explanation, so fuck off!â Aaden replies.
âYou selfish little prick. All youâve done since you got here is toy around with her. You even brought your one-night stand in the house to torment her. Seriously, what the hell is wrong with you?â Bex says, refusing to let the subject drop.
